Sangor in context

With 563 people at the 2011 Census, Sangor was the 1066th most populous of its district's 1199 villages, below the district average of 2,049.

Literacy stood at 76.13%, 8.8 points above the district's rural average of 67.34%.

The sex ratio was 941 women per 1,000 men (64 above the district's rural figure of 877).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 750, 173 below the rural national 923.
